The perp was eventually caught red-handed after his bloody handprint was discovered on the coach, which did mark a first: the use of fingerprinting technology to catch a criminal. Twain visited and wrote about many places throughout the Silver State, but it is here in Unionville where he first learned the hard way, as he observes in Roughing It, that all that glitters is not gold. Fortunately for lovers of history and Twains literature alike, it is also here in Unionville that the cabin where that episode unfolds still stands. Thanks to plentiful silver in the surrounding hills, Belmont once boasted a population of 15,000, hence a whole lot of seriously amazing ruins, including a bank, miners cabins, the storied Belmont Courthouse, abandoned mine shafts, 100-foot-tall brick chimneys, and the picture-perfect combination stamp mill ruins shown above. Towering over the Reese River Valley at Austins western edge, Stokes Castle was modeled after a real Roman tower for well-heeled railroad magnate, Anson Phelps Stokes, in the late 1890s. When a settler first discovered gold around 1860, it didnt take long for Bodie to become a prosperous town. Are we talkin northern or southern Nevada? By 1880 there were around 10,000 people living in Bodie and 65 saloons that profited off on gambling and alcohol. Calico's 1881 silver strike was the largest in California history.
